Risk of gastrointestinal (GI) immune-related adverse events (irAEs): Real-world experience.

Abstract

e23410 Background: Immune checkpoint inhibitors (ICI) improve survival across solid tumors but can cause gastrointestinal (GI) irAEs. Real-world comparative data remains limited, particularly for composite GI outcomes. We compared the risk of GI AEs in patients receiving immunotherapy (IT) versus non-IT systemic therapy. Methods: We conducted a retrospective cohort study of 5,556 adult cancer patients treated at Cleveland Clinic Ohio between 2010–2022. Included cancers were advanced-stages bladder, endometrial, esophageal, gastric, head & neck, renal, bladder, melanoma & lung cancers, stages where IT is approved. We compared IT (± chemo/radiation) vs non-IT regimens; 99.9% of IT was ICI. Follow-up began at systemic therapy start & continued until GI-AE, death or last encounter. GI AEs included diarrhea, colitis, elevated liver enzymes, esophagitis, gastritis, enteritis, enterocolitis, & composite outcomes. Poisson regression estimated incidence rates, Kaplan–Meier methods cumulative incidence (CIR) & time-dependent Cox models (TD-HR) assessed risk with IT as a time-varying exposure. Longitudinal serum liver tests were analyzed using mixed-effects & generalized linear models over one year. Results: Among 5,556 patients, 1,288 (23%) received first-line IT & 951 (17%) second-line IT. Median age was 66 years; 38% were female & 87% White. There were 430 GI-AE & 268 entero-colonic composite events in median follow up of 14 months (CI: 6-34). Incidence rates (/100 person-years) were higher with IT for GI-AE (0.50 vs 0.27) & entero-colonic composites (0.31 vs 0.16) (P < 0.05). IT was associated with decreased esophagitis risk (TD-HR 0.26; P = 0.01). Among colitis cases, 48% were grade 2, 25% grade 3 & 18% grade 4; 89% required treatment, 46% received immunomodulators & 37% permanently discontinued therapy. Longitudinal liver analyses showed IT was associated with increased albumin (β = 0.04; P = 0.04) & decreased INR (β = −0.26; P = 0.04), with no change in ALT, AST, alkaline phosphatase, total bilirubin, or APTT. Baseline values strongly predicted longitudinal changes, & alkaline phosphatase, ALT, total bilirubin & APTT increased over time (P < 0.05). Conclusions: IT was frequently associated with GI AEs, reaching 15% at 4 years, though most were low-to-moderate grade & manageable. IT was associated with selective laboratory changes, while baseline liver values remained the strongest predictors. Lower esophagitis incidence may reflect reduced radiation exposure. Hepatic synthetic markers improved with IT. IT group (n=1,288) Non-IT group (n=4,268) Colitis: absolute number 29 28 Colitis: 2-year CIR / TD-HR TD-HR 2.5% (1.5%, 3.5%) / HR 5.2 (3.0, 9.0) 0.6% (0.4%, 0.9%) / Ref Diarrhea: absolute number 45 157 Diarrhea: CIR / TD-HR 4.3% (3.0%, 5.7%) / HR 1.4 (1.1, 1.9) 4.0% (3.3%, 4.7%) / Ref Elevated liver enzymes: absolute number 41 67 Elevated liver enzymes: CIR / TD-HR 3.8% (2.6%, 5.1%)/ HR 3.2 (2.2, 4.7) 1.7% (1.3%, 2.2%)/ Ref
